45 /// Represents a pseudo instruction which replaces a G_SHUFFLE_VECTOR.
46 ///
47 /// Used for matching target-supported shuffles before codegen.
48 struct ShuffleVectorPseudo {
49   unsigned Opc; ///< Opcode for the instruction. (E.g. G_ZIP1)
50   Register Dst; ///< Destination register.
51   SmallVector<SrcOp, 2> SrcOps; ///< Source registers.
52   ShuffleVectorPseudo(unsigned Opc, Register Dst,
53                       std::initializer_list<SrcOp> SrcOps)
54       : Opc(Opc), Dst(Dst), SrcOps(SrcOps){};
55   ShuffleVectorPseudo() {}
56 };
57 
58 /// Check if a vector shuffle corresponds to a REV instruction with the
59 /// specified blocksize.
60 static bool isREVMask(ArrayRef<int> M, unsigned EltSize, unsigned NumElts,
61                       unsigned BlockSize) {
62   assert((BlockSize == 16 || BlockSize == 32 || BlockSize == 64) &&
63          "Only possible block sizes for REV are: 16, 32, 64");
64   assert(EltSize != 64 && "EltSize cannot be 64 for REV mask.");
65 
66   unsigned BlockElts = M[0] + 1;
67 
68   // If the first shuffle index is UNDEF, be optimistic.
69   if (M[0] < 0)
70     BlockElts = BlockSize / EltSize;
71 
72   if (BlockSize <= EltSize || BlockSize != BlockElts * EltSize)
73     return false;
74 
75   for (unsigned i = 0; i < NumElts; ++i) {
76     // Ignore undef indices.
77     if (M[i] < 0)
78       continue;
79     if (static_cast<unsigned>(M[i]) !=
80         (i - i % BlockElts) + (BlockElts - 1 - i % BlockElts))
81       return false;
82   }
83 
84   return true;
85 }
86 
87 /// Determines if \p M is a shuffle vector mask for a TRN of \p NumElts.
88 /// Whether or not G_TRN1 or G_TRN2 should be used is stored in \p WhichResult.
89 static bool isTRNMask(ArrayRef<int> M, unsigned NumElts,
90                       unsigned &WhichResult) {
91   if (NumElts % 2 != 0)
92     return false;
93   WhichResult = (M[0] == 0 ? 0 : 1);
94   for (unsigned i = 0; i < NumElts; i += 2) {
95     if ((M[i] >= 0 && static_cast<unsigned>(M[i]) != i + WhichResult) ||
96         (M[i + 1] >= 0 &&
97          static_cast<unsigned>(M[i + 1]) != i + NumElts + WhichResult))
98       return false;
99   }
100   return true;
101 }
102 
103 /// Check if a G_EXT instruction can handle a shuffle mask \p M when the vector
104 /// sources of the shuffle are different.
105 static Optional<std::pair<bool, uint64_t>> getExtMask(ArrayRef<int> M,
106                                                       unsigned NumElts) {
107   // Look for the first non-undef element.
108   auto FirstRealElt = find_if(M, [](int Elt) { return Elt >= 0; });
109   if (FirstRealElt == M.end())
110     return None;
111 
112   // Use APInt to handle overflow when calculating expected element.
113   unsigned MaskBits = APInt(32, NumElts * 2).logBase2();
114   APInt ExpectedElt = APInt(MaskBits, *FirstRealElt + 1);
115 
116   // The following shuffle indices must be the successive elements after the
117   // first real element.
118   if (any_of(
119           make_range(std::next(FirstRealElt), M.end()),
120           [&ExpectedElt](int Elt) { return Elt != ExpectedElt++ && Elt >= 0; }))
121     return None;
122 
123   // The index of an EXT is the first element if it is not UNDEF.
124   // Watch out for the beginning UNDEFs. The EXT index should be the expected
125   // value of the first element.  E.g.
126   // <-1, -1, 3, ...> is treated as <1, 2, 3, ...>.
127   // <-1, -1, 0, 1, ...> is treated as <2*NumElts-2, 2*NumElts-1, 0, 1, ...>.
128   // ExpectedElt is the last mask index plus 1.
129   uint64_t Imm = ExpectedElt.getZExtValue();
130   bool ReverseExt = false;
131 
132   // There are two difference cases requiring to reverse input vectors.
133   // For example, for vector <4 x i32> we have the following cases,
134   // Case 1: shufflevector(<4 x i32>,<4 x i32>,<-1, -1, -1, 0>)
135   // Case 2: shufflevector(<4 x i32>,<4 x i32>,<-1, -1, 7, 0>)
136   // For both cases, we finally use mask <5, 6, 7, 0>, which requires
137   // to reverse two input vectors.
138   if (Imm < NumElts)
139     ReverseExt = true;
140   else
141     Imm -= NumElts;
142   return std::make_pair(ReverseExt, Imm);
143 }

506 /// Determine if it is possible to modify the \p RHS and predicate \p P of a
507 /// G_ICMP instruction such that the right-hand side is an arithmetic immediate.
508 ///
509 /// \returns A pair containing the updated immediate and predicate which may
510 /// be used to optimize the instruction.
511 ///
512 /// \note This assumes that the comparison has been legalized.
513 Optional<std::pair<uint64_t, CmpInst::Predicate>>
514 tryAdjustICmpImmAndPred(Register RHS, CmpInst::Predicate P,
515                           const MachineRegisterInfo &MRI) {
516   const auto &Ty = MRI.getType(RHS);
517   if (Ty.isVector())
518     return None;
519   unsigned Size = Ty.getSizeInBits();
520   assert((Size == 32 || Size == 64) && "Expected 32 or 64 bit compare only?");
521 
522   // If the RHS is not a constant, or the RHS is already a valid arithmetic
523   // immediate, then there is nothing to change.
524   auto ValAndVReg = getConstantVRegValWithLookThrough(RHS, MRI);
525   if (!ValAndVReg)
526     return None;
527   uint64_t C = ValAndVReg->Value.getZExtValue();
528   if (isLegalArithImmed(C))
529     return None;
530 
531   // We have a non-arithmetic immediate. Check if adjusting the immediate and
532   // adjusting the predicate will result in a legal arithmetic immediate.
533   switch (P) {
534   default:
535     return None;
536   case CmpInst::ICMP_SLT:
537   case CmpInst::ICMP_SGE:
538     // Check for
539     //
540     // x slt c => x sle c - 1
541     // x sge c => x sgt c - 1
542     //
543     // When c is not the smallest possible negative number.
544     if ((Size == 64 && static_cast<int64_t>(C) == INT64_MIN) ||
545         (Size == 32 && static_cast<int32_t>(C) == INT32_MIN))
546       return None;
547     P = (P == CmpInst::ICMP_SLT) ? CmpInst::ICMP_SLE : CmpInst::ICMP_SGT;
548     C -= 1;
549     break;
550   case CmpInst::ICMP_ULT:
551   case CmpInst::ICMP_UGE:
552     // Check for
553     //
554     // x ult c => x ule c - 1
555     // x uge c => x ugt c - 1
556     //
557     // When c is not zero.
558     if (C == 0)
559       return None;
560     P = (P == CmpInst::ICMP_ULT) ? CmpInst::ICMP_ULE : CmpInst::ICMP_UGT;
561     C -= 1;
562     break;
563   case CmpInst::ICMP_SLE:
564   case CmpInst::ICMP_SGT:
565     // Check for
566     //
567     // x sle c => x slt c + 1
568     // x sgt c => s sge c + 1
569     //
570     // When c is not the largest possible signed integer.
571     if ((Size == 32 && static_cast<int32_t>(C) == INT32_MAX) ||
572         (Size == 64 && static_cast<int64_t>(C) == INT64_MAX))
573       return None;
574     P = (P == CmpInst::ICMP_SLE) ? CmpInst::ICMP_SLT : CmpInst::ICMP_SGE;
575     C += 1;
576     break;
577   case CmpInst::ICMP_ULE:
578   case CmpInst::ICMP_UGT:
579     // Check for
580     //
581     // x ule c => x ult c + 1
582     // x ugt c => s uge c + 1
583     //
584     // When c is not the largest possible unsigned integer.
585     if ((Size == 32 && static_cast<uint32_t>(C) == UINT32_MAX) ||
586         (Size == 64 && C == UINT64_MAX))
587       return None;
588     P = (P == CmpInst::ICMP_ULE) ? CmpInst::ICMP_ULT : CmpInst::ICMP_UGE;
589     C += 1;
590     break;
591   }
592 
593   // Check if the new constant is valid, and return the updated constant and
594   // predicate if it is.
595   if (Size == 32)
596     C = static_cast<uint32_t>(C);
597   if (!isLegalArithImmed(C))
598     return None;
599   return {{C, P}};
600 }

738 /// \returns how many instructions would be saved by folding a G_ICMP's shift
739 /// and/or extension operations.
740 static unsigned getCmpOperandFoldingProfit(Register CmpOp,
741                                            const MachineRegisterInfo &MRI) {
742   // No instructions to save if there's more than one use or no uses.
743   if (!MRI.hasOneNonDBGUse(CmpOp))
744     return 0;
745 
746   // FIXME: This is duplicated with the selector. (See: selectShiftedRegister)
747   auto IsSupportedExtend = [&](const MachineInstr &MI) {
748     if (MI.getOpcode() == TargetOpcode::G_SEXT_INREG)
749       return true;
750     if (MI.getOpcode() != TargetOpcode::G_AND)
751       return false;
752     auto ValAndVReg =
753         getConstantVRegValWithLookThrough(MI.getOperand(2).getReg(), MRI);
754     if (!ValAndVReg)
755       return false;
756     uint64_t Mask = ValAndVReg->Value.getZExtValue();
757     return (Mask == 0xFF || Mask == 0xFFFF || Mask == 0xFFFFFFFF);
758   };
759 
760   MachineInstr *Def = getDefIgnoringCopies(CmpOp, MRI);
761   if (IsSupportedExtend(*Def))
762     return 1;
763 
764   unsigned Opc = Def->getOpcode();
765   if (Opc != TargetOpcode::G_SHL && Opc != TargetOpcode::G_ASHR &&
766       Opc != TargetOpcode::G_LSHR)
767     return 0;
768 
769   auto MaybeShiftAmt =
770       getConstantVRegValWithLookThrough(Def->getOperand(2).getReg(), MRI);
771   if (!MaybeShiftAmt)
772     return 0;
773   uint64_t ShiftAmt = MaybeShiftAmt->Value.getZExtValue();
774   MachineInstr *ShiftLHS =
775       getDefIgnoringCopies(Def->getOperand(1).getReg(), MRI);
776 
777   // Check if we can fold an extend and a shift.
778   // FIXME: This is duplicated with the selector. (See:
779   // selectArithExtendedRegister)
780   if (IsSupportedExtend(*ShiftLHS))
781     return (ShiftAmt <= 4) ? 2 : 1;
782 
783   LLT Ty = MRI.getType(Def->getOperand(0).getReg());
784   if (Ty.isVector())
785     return 0;
786   unsigned ShiftSize = Ty.getSizeInBits();
787   if ((ShiftSize == 32 && ShiftAmt <= 31) ||
788       (ShiftSize == 64 && ShiftAmt <= 63))
789     return 1;
790   return 0;
791 }
792 
793 /// \returns true if it would be profitable to swap the LHS and RHS of a G_ICMP
794 /// instruction \p MI.
795 static bool trySwapICmpOperands(MachineInstr &MI,
796                                  const MachineRegisterInfo &MRI) {
797   assert(MI.getOpcode() == TargetOpcode::G_ICMP);
798   // Swap the operands if it would introduce a profitable folding opportunity.
799   // (e.g. a shift + extend).
800   //
801   //  For example:
802   //    lsl     w13, w11, #1
803   //    cmp     w13, w12
804   // can be turned into:
805   //    cmp     w12, w11, lsl #1
806 
807   // Don't swap if there's a constant on the RHS, because we know we can fold
808   // that.
809   Register RHS = MI.getOperand(3).getReg();
810   auto RHSCst = getConstantVRegValWithLookThrough(RHS, MRI);
811   if (RHSCst && isLegalArithImmed(RHSCst->Value.getSExtValue()))
812     return false;
813 
814   Register LHS = MI.getOperand(2).getReg();
815   auto Pred = static_cast<CmpInst::Predicate>(MI.getOperand(1).getPredicate());
816   auto GetRegForProfit = [&](Register Reg) {
817     MachineInstr *Def = getDefIgnoringCopies(Reg, MRI);
818     return isCMN(Def, Pred, MRI) ? Def->getOperand(2).getReg() : Reg;
819   };
820 
821   // Don't have a constant on the RHS. If we swap the LHS and RHS of the
822   // compare, would we be able to fold more instructions?
823   Register TheLHS = GetRegForProfit(LHS);
824   Register TheRHS = GetRegForProfit(RHS);
825 
826   // If the LHS is more likely to give us a folding opportunity, then swap the
827   // LHS and RHS.
828   return (getCmpOperandFoldingProfit(TheLHS, MRI) >
829           getCmpOperandFoldingProfit(TheRHS, MRI));
830 }
